So, **** all of that ****.) I've only recently become familiar with Sarcofago but this album has already become one of my new favorite metal albums. If you've ever heard De Mysteriis Dom Sathanas then you have a good idea of what this sounds like, cause Euronymous was obviously wearing his copy out when he wrote that album. This album is composed of only the filthiest and most simplistic of thrash, early black and death metal, and hardcore. It's sloppy and unnuanced and ****ty sounding and is probably one of the most intense albums of the eighties. Seriously, until De Mysteriis I don't know if there was a band that used and abused the blast beat quite so flagrantly as Sarcofago. From the retched vocals to the abysmal production to the awful musicianship to the aforementioned drumming this is an ugly, ugly thing with no redeeming value for Trollheart.
